Holiday Poke Cake

SUBMITTED BY: JELL-O 

"This festive cake with red and green jell-o will be a hit at your holiday gatherings."
PREP TIME  15 Min
READY IN  4 Hrs 15 Min

INGREDIENTS

  • 2 baked 9-inch round white cake layers, cooled
  • 2 cups boiling water
  • 1 pkg. (4 serving size) JELL-O Brand Gelatin, any red flavor
  • 1 pkg. (4 serving size) JELL-O Brand Lime Flavor Gelatin
  • 1 (8 ounce) tub COOL WHIP Whipped Topping, thawed

DIRECTIONS

  1. Place cake layers, top sides up, in 2 clean 9-inch round cake pans. Pierce layers with large fork at 1/2-inch intervals.
  2. Stir 1 cup of the boiling water into each flavor of dry gelatin mix in separate bowls at least 2 minutes until completely dissolved. Carefully pour red gelatin over 1 cake layer and lime gelatin over second cake layer. Refrigerate 3 hours.
  3. Dip 1 cake pan in warm water 10 seconds; unmold onto serving plate. Spread with about 1 cup of the whipped topping. Unmold second cake layer; carefully place on first cake layer. Frost top and side of cake with remaining whipped topping.
  4. Refrigerate at least 1 hour or until ready to serve. Decorate with fresh raspberries, if desired. Store leftover cake in refrigerator.
